Background
Cardiac haemangiomas are exceptionally rare. They are usually solitary growths. Cardiac haemangiomas can be classified as capillary, cavernous, or arteriovenous in nature. They can occur in any chambers of the heart, but are predominantly found at the intramural or endocardial layers.
Case presentation
This is a rare case of a cardiac haemangioma located on the epicardium of a 52-year-old male patient. The patient complained of 1-year duration of chest tightness and shortness of breath. The haemangioma was removed successfully. For symptomatic lesions, surgical removal remains the preferred treatment.
Conclusion
The pathological diagnosis was primary cardiac cavernous haemangioma. In this case, the haemangioma was successfully resected with invasive surgery. No recurrence was detected on follow up.
BackgroundAn aberrant right subclavian artery which arises from the proximal descending aorta may result in aortic dissection. The dissection may occur at either the site of the primary intimal tear or from an aortic branch. These conditions may lead to blood flow limitation and possible aneurysmal degeneration in the future.Case presentationWe described the clinical presentation and management of a 54-year old patient diagnosed with a rare case of an aberrant right subclavian artery with Stanford Type B aortic dissection. A hybrid surgical approach was successfully performed and the patient had an uneventful recovery.ConclusionEven though aortic dissection is often an incidental finding, this case highlighted that in rare situations, it can be associated with an aberrant right subclavian artery. It is important to disseminate this association as it has profound diagnostic and therapeutic implications in safeguarding the clinical outcomes of patients with such condition.
Objectives
To summarise the surgical outcomes in patients with cardiogenic shock supported by preoperative extracorporeal membrane oxygenation (ECMO).
Methods
Between May 2012 and August 2017, eight patients with cardiogenic shock, who were supported by ECMO, underwent emergency surgery; four of them had isolated coronary artery bypass grafting, three had coronary artery bypass grafting with mitral replacement, and one had mitral valve replacement with left ventricular posterior wall repair.
Results
All eight patients were successfully weaned off from ECMO after their surgeries. Postoperative ECMO time ranged from 6.8 to 228.0 h, with a median of 68.4 h. Two patients died postoperatively while another six survived. The follow up time for the six patients ranged from three to 66 months, whereby one of them died in the third month due to septicaemia. The remaining five patients survived with good cardiac function based on the NYHA classification.
Conclusion
ECMO is a vital bridge in the preparation of critically-ill patients for cardiac surgery. It is associated with acceptable outcomes among most of the patients.
